ECARX Holdings Inc. fell 8.0952% in pre-market trading on Dec. 9, 2025, signaling a sharp reversal in investor sentiment. The steep decline came amid mounting concerns over competitive pressures in the autonomous driving sector and evolving regulatory scrutiny.
Analysts noted that recent developments in the broader EV ecosystem have cast shadows over ECARX’s growth trajectory. Reports highlighted intensifying competition from rival tech firms accelerating software updates and partnerships with major automakers. The stock’s pre-market slump reflects broader market skepticism about the company’s ability to differentiate its AI-driven solutions in a rapidly consolidating industry. While ECARX has positioned itself as a leader in connected car technologies, recent quarterly updates have emphasized incremental rather than transformative advancements, fueling caution among institutional investors.
With no major earnings reports or strategic announcements in the immediate pipeline, the decline underscores the sector’s sensitivity to macroeconomic signals and technological momentum. Traders are now closely watching for clarity on ECARX’s roadmap for 2026, particularly as global automakers prepare to unveil next-generation vehicle platforms.
